2009: The first holiday tradition begins with lots and lots of decorative trees.



2010: The decorations spread throughout the White House.


2011: A new take on modern Christmas with papier-mâché trees and a Bo sculpture. (Yes, please.)



2012: The decorations were filled with more Bo, more red, and more balloons because why not?



2013: They decided on a bold statement of not just red and green, but all the colors of the rainbow.



2014: Not one, but two dogs now, with the addition of Sunny to the family.


2015 : At this point, if you're not using your pets as the staple of holidays you're doing everything wrong.



2016: For their last year (cue the tears), they combined female empowerment, winter wonderland, and an avant-garde look.
